Based on your results of NET VIEW, you should be able to access the laptop resources after typing the following command on MOM or DAD: NET USE * \\192.168.0.2\D (the D on the end refers to the D share you've created on LAPTOP). I'm not sure why you're getting access denied while using the name. I would try changing the computer name of the laptop just to see if that alters the problem. Turning off the XP firewall is low risk when there's a router between you and the Internet.
